Thursday Maywood Pick-6 pool guaranteed at $15,000

by Michael Antoniades, Chicago Racing Analyst

Melrose Park, IL — A three-day Pick-6 carryover on Thursday and the $92,000 Maywood Pace on Friday will make for a busy two nights of action as racing resumes on Thursday (June 19) at Maywood Park.

The USTA and Maywood Park have announced a guaranteed pool of $15,000 for the Thursday Pick-6, which has a carryover of $4,283 and will start on the second race at approximately 7:30 p.m. (CDT).

The Maywood Park Pick-6 has a 20 cent minimum. This is a traditional Pick-6 and is not a jackpot wager requiring a single winner to take down the entire pool. The four day jackpot will be paid to the people that can correctly select the winners on races two through seven.

The Maywood Pick-4 will follow on races eight through 11 on Thursday. The one dollar wager offers a guaranteed pool of $7,500 and a low takeout of 15 percent. The Thursday Pick-4 pools are growing more popular in June, averaging $12,826. The Pick-4 is also doing brisk business on Fridays in June, averaging $15,940. The Friday Pick-4 has a guaranteed pool of $10,000.

Speaking of Fridays, Maywood will host one of its signature events, the $92,000 Maywood Pace, on June 20. The field of eight 3-year-olds will battle it out Friday in the ninth race with a post time of 9:50 p.m. Below is the field:
